Bonjour ou bonsoir a tous et voila une fois de plus confronter a un probleme qui apparement est sans reponse sur le forum us
j'aimerai pouvoir de la meme maniere que les autres items ( bouton ,input ,label,etc) les rezise automatiquement pour ce faire pour le moment soit on utilise l'option en entete
Opt("GUIResizeMode", $GUI_DOCKAUTO)
ou soit sous chaque item GUICtrlSetResizing (-1,$GUI_DOCKAUTO)
mais voila les GUICtrlCreateGraphic ne sont pas pris en compte et ca m'embette enormement
il est ecrit dans la doc
This control cannot be resized due to fix graphic relative addressing creation but can be dock with GUICtrlSetResizing().
mais je ne comprend pas bien la tournure la fin de la phrase can be dock with GUICtrlSetResizing()
j'espere sincerement qu'il y est une solution :S
si quelqu'un a deja ete confronter a ce probleme et qu'il a une solution c'est le moment de repondre
a oui j'oubliai voila un petit exemple tout simple qui explique bien mon probleme
► Afficher le texte
Code : Tout sélectionner
#include <ButtonConstants.au3>
#include <GUIConstantsEx.au3>
#include <WindowsConstants.au3>
Opt("GUIResizeMode", $GUI_DOCKAUTO)
#Region ### START Koda GUI section ### Form=
$Form2 = GUICreate("Form2", 430, 241,-1,-1, BitOR($GUI_SS_DEFAULT_GUI,$WS_MAXIMIZEBOX,$WS_TABSTOP))
GUICtrlCreateGraphic(60,30,320, 40, $WS_EX_STATICEDGE)
GUICtrlSetResizing (-1,$GUI_DOCKAUTO)
GUICtrlSetBkColor(-1, 0x7ACAF7)
GUICtrlSetColor(-1, 0xffffff)
$Button1 = GUICtrlCreateButton("Button1", 202, 37, 33, 25)
$Button2 = GUICtrlCreateButton("Button1", 252, 37, 33, 25)
$Button3 = GUICtrlCreateButton("Button1", 138, 37, 33, 25)
$Button4 = GUICtrlCreateButton("Button1", 70, 37, 33, 25)
$Button5 = GUICtrlCreateButton("Button1", 334, 37, 33, 25)
GUISetState(@SW_SHOW)
#EndRegion ### END Koda GUI section ###
While 1
$nMsg = GUIGetMsg()
Switch $nMsg
Case $GUI_EVENT_CLOSE
Exit
EndSwitch
WEnd
on s'apercois bien que le rectangle ne s'etire pas comme les boutton quand on clique sur le maximize